Originally added in 12f996edfab67b65af0ff1ee829f9eeabb025b0f behind #if 0; aebb56e1844d61965c97e95534c3ae0da69df028 then removed the #if and replaced it by using av_dlog. Then commit 1a3eb042c704dea190c644def5b32c9cee8832b8 replaced this with av_log at trace level. Yet the code block always stayed within { } at an increased level of indentation.
